delphi UniFileUploadButton实现多文件一次上传功能  
官方Delphi 学习QQ群: 682628230(三千人)
频道

delphi UniFileUploadButton实现多文件一次上传功能


UniFileUploadButton实现多文件一次上传功能

20150827210941235.png

限制一次上传的文件数量及限制文件大小在此进行设置,上传过程的提示信息等也在此汉化。直接上码:


procedure TMainForm.UniFileUploadButton1MultiCompleted(Sender: TObject;

  Files: TUniFileInfoArray);

var

  i:integer;

  DestName : string;

  DestFolder : string;

begin

  //先要在当前运行程序文件夹下创建这个UploadFolder文件夹将文件 存到UploadFolder文件夹,

  // UniFileUploadButton1.MultipleFiles:=True;//多选 模式

   for i :=low(files) to high(files) do

   begin

     DestFolder:=UniServerModule.StartPath+'UploadFolder\';   //要在与exe同下新建一个UploadFolder文件夹

     DestName:=DestFolder+ExtractFileName(Files[i].Stream.FileName);

     CopyFile(PChar(Files[i].Stream.FileName), PChar(DestName), False);

   end;

end;

————————————————


原文链接:https://blog.csdn.net/tvmerp/article/details/107836053



推荐分享
图文皆来源于网络,内容仅做公益性分享,版权归原作者所有,如有侵权请告知删除!
 

Copyright © 2014 DelphiW.com 开发 源码 文档 技巧 All Rights Reserved
晋ICP备14006235号-8 晋公网安备 14108102000087号

执行时间: 0.051993131637573 seconds